71st National Film Awards: Winner List

The winners of the 71st National Film Awards were announced on August 1, showcasing the diversity of cinema across languages, genres, and crafts. Vidhu Vinod Chopra’s 12th Fail won Best Feature Film, while the offbeat comedy Kathal – A Jackfruit Mystery was selected as Best Hindi Film. Shah Rukh Khan (Jawan) and Vikrant Massey (12th Fail) will share the Best Actor award, while Rani Mukerji received Best Actress for her powerful performance in Mrs. Chatterjee vs Norway.

Also, Malayalam superstar Mohanlal will be conferred with the prestigious Dadasaheb Phalke Award 2023. While sharing it with the world on social media, the Ministry of Information and Broadcasting on X wrote, “On the recommendation of the Dadasaheb Phalke Award Selection Committee, the Government of India is pleased to announce that Shri Mohanlal will be conferred the prestigious Dadasaheb Phalke Award 2023. Mohanlal’s remarkable cinematic journey inspires generations! The legendary actor, director, and producer is being honoured for his iconic contribution to Indian cinema. His unmatched talent, versatility, and relentless hard work have set a golden standard in Indian film history. The award will be presented at the 71st National Film Awards ceremony on Sept 23, 2025.”

Shah Rukh Khan’s work front:

The actor is currently busy with the shoot of his upcoming action drama King. The film is a multi-starrer with Abhay Verma, Deepika Padukone, Rani Mukerji, Jaideep Ahlawat, Arshad Warsi, and Saurabh Shukla, among others. The film is slated for a 2026 release.

Meanwhile, Shah Rukh Khan is celebrating the release of The Ba***ds of Bollywood, directed by his son Aryan Khan, which premiered on Netflix on September 18. The film stars Bobby Deol, Lakshya, Raghav Juyal, Sahher Bambba, Anya Singh, Mona Singh, and Manoj Pahwa, and has been receiving positive reviews from both audiences and critics.
